The Block Chain Data Structure Provides New Properties

The public block chains are only used for the crypto currencies. A private block chain is a limited, writer, append only data structure translation. There's a few number of people allowed to atually add to the data store. So a block chain is nothing more than a signed hash chain. We've had signed hash chain services in 19 99. They just aren't all that useful really. The only thing that block chain adds in that context is it has a super power. It allows you to spew whatever bul you want, and nobody calls you on it.
